☐ Roof terrace: the door at the top of the east stairwell in Bramley House jams regularly, so don't assume it's locked when it sticks. Push firmly at the top corner while turning the handle. Report any jam to the facilities desk rather than forcing it. Once it gives, the keypad on the frame takes the code below.

door code, yagap-bahof: bdg-O-05

// Client setup for the Tidysweep stale-branch cleanup bot.
// Plugin authors must construct one client per repository;
// sharing clients across repos breaks the bot's per-repo
// rate accounting and can delay branch deletion sweeps.
// The client authenticates against Tidysweep's internal
// control service on construction and fails fast if the
// credential is invalid. Initialize it with the key below.

app token of bawep-hafog = kto7_vwrmnlx

### Vendor note: Northgate LB health checks

For the weekly sync: our managed load balancer vendor, Northgate Systems, changed default health-check intervals from 10s to 30s in their latest platform update. This delayed ejection of a bad Copperfield API node last Tuesday, causing roughly four minutes of elevated errors. We've overridden the interval back to 10s in our contract tier and asked for change notifications going forward. Escalations and SLA questions for Northgate go to their support desk below.

escalation mailbox, bafog-fafog: ulador@paliqlabs.internal

## Onboarding: Liftrace Simulator Access

Welcome to the Liftrace team. The elevator-dispatch simulator replays building traffic against our scheduling algorithms; always run it in the sandbox tenant first. Results post to the Shaftboard dashboard automatically. To let your local simulator publish runs, configure it with the internal key provided below.

service key, fawip-bajef: kto11_Qt5wZK9vdNC

**Q: How does the TileBurrow prefetcher authenticate its cache-seeding account?**

TileBurrow pulls map tiles ahead of viewport movement using a dedicated service account scoped to read-only tile access. The account's credentials rotate monthly via the Vexhall secrets manager, and no session tokens persist on disk. For audit continuity, the recovery credential for the seeding account is escrowed here rather than in the rotation system, per our reviewer's earlier request. The escrowed recovery passphrase follows below.

strongbox words: zormir-quenath-sorax